ZF2: как получить экземпляр ServiceManager из пользовательского класса

Я не могу понять, как получить экземпляр ServiceManager из пользовательского класса.

Внутри контроллера этолегко

$this->getServiceLocator()->get('My\CustomLogger')->log(5, 'my message');

Теперь я создал несколько независимых классов, и мне нужно получитьZend\Log экземпляр внутри этого класса. В Zend Framework v.1 я сделал это через статический вызов:

Zend_Registry::get('myCustomLogger');

Как я могу получитьMy\CustomLogger в ZF2?

Ответы на вопрос(1)

Ваш ответ на вопрос